Wall Street Titan Druckenmiller Predicts Stablecoins Will Power the Future of Global Payments

Share This Post

Wall Street legend Stanley Druckenmiller just tossed a polite grenade into the global payments debate, predicting that within 10 to 15 years the machinery moving money around the planet won’t rely on SWIFT wires or card networks—but on blockchain-powered stablecoins that settle transactions faster, cheaper, and without bankers checking the clock.
